// ISO C++ 14882: 22.2.1.1.2  ctype virtual functions.
//

// Written by Benjamin Kosnik <bkoz@redhat.com>

#include <locale>
#include <bits/c++locale_internal.h>

namespace std
{
  // NB: The other ctype<char> specializations are in src/locale.cc and
  // various /config/os/* files.
  template<>
    ctype_byname<char>::ctype_byname(const char* __s, size_t __refs)
    : ctype<char>(0, false, __refs) 
    { 		
      if (std::strcmp(__s, "C") != 0 && std::strcmp(__s, "POSIX") != 0)
	{
	  this->_S_destroy_c_locale(this->_M_c_locale_ctype);
	  this->_S_create_c_locale(this->_M_c_locale_ctype, __s); 
	}
    }

#ifdef _GLIBCXX_USE_WCHAR_T  
  ctype<wchar_t>::__wmask_type
  ctype<wchar_t>::_M_convert_to_wmask(const mask __m) const
  {
    // Darwin uses the same codes for 'char' as 'wchar_t', so this routine
    // never gets called.
    return __m;
  };
  
  wchar_t
  ctype<wchar_t>::do_toupper(wchar_t __c) const
  { return towupper(__c); }

  const wchar_t*
  ctype<wchar_t>::do_toupper(wchar_t* __lo, const wchar_t* __hi) const
  {
    while (__lo < __hi)
      {
        *__lo = towupper(*__lo);
        ++__lo;
      }
    return __hi;
  }
  
  wchar_t
  ctype<wchar_t>::do_tolower(wchar_t __c) const
  { return towlower(__c); }
  
  const wchar_t*
  ctype<wchar_t>::do_tolower(wchar_t* __lo, const wchar_t* __hi) const
  {
    while (__lo < __hi)
      {
        *__lo = towlower(*__lo);
        ++__lo;
      }
    return __hi;
  }

  wchar_t
  ctype<wchar_t>::
  do_widen(char __c) const
  { return _M_widen[static_cast<unsigned char>(__c)]; }

  const char* 
  ctype<wchar_t>::
  do_widen(const char* __lo, const char* __hi, wchar_t* __dest) const
  {
    while (__lo < __hi)
      {
	*__dest = _M_widen[static_cast<unsigned char>(*__lo)];
	++__lo;
	++__dest;
      }
    return __hi;
  }

  char
  ctype<wchar_t>::
  do_narrow(wchar_t __wc, char __dfault) const
  { 
    if (__wc >= 0 && __wc < 128 && _M_narrow_ok)
      return _M_narrow[__wc];
    const int __c = wctob(__wc);
    return (__c == EOF ? __dfault : static_cast<char>(__c)); 
  }

  const wchar_t*
  ctype<wchar_t>::
  do_narrow(const wchar_t* __lo, const wchar_t* __hi, char __dfault, 
	    char* __dest) const
  {
    if (_M_narrow_ok)
      while (__lo < __hi)
	{
	  if (*__lo >= 0 && *__lo < 128)
	    *__dest = _M_narrow[*__lo];
	  else
	    {
	      const int __c = wctob(*__lo);
	      *__dest = (__c == EOF ? __dfault : static_cast<char>(__c));
	    }
	  ++__lo;
	  ++__dest;
	}
    else
      while (__lo < __hi)
	{
	  const int __c = wctob(*__lo);
	  *__dest = (__c == EOF ? __dfault : static_cast<char>(__c));
	  ++__lo;
	  ++__dest;
	}
    return __hi;
  }

  void
  ctype<wchar_t>::_M_initialize_ctype()
  {
    wint_t __i;
    for (__i = 0; __i < 128; ++__i)
      {
	const int __c = wctob(__i);
	if (__c == EOF)
	  break;
	else
	  _M_narrow[__i] = static_cast<char>(__c);
      }
    if (__i == 128)
      _M_narrow_ok = true;
    else
      _M_narrow_ok = false;
    for (size_t __i = 0;
	 __i < sizeof(_M_widen) / sizeof(wint_t); ++__i)
      _M_widen[__i] = btowc(__i);
  }
#endif //  _GLIBCXX_USE_WCHAR_T
}
